AISO makes your brand the trusted answer in AI-driven search.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">In this blog, we will explain how SEO and AISO differ, why they are most effective together, and how using both helps your business stay visible, credible, and competitive within the evolving search ecosystem.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>Core Principles: Understanding the Engine<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.ralecon.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/Core-Principles_-Understanding-the-Engine-2.png\"><img loading=\"lazy\" class=\"aligncenter wp-image-1534 size-full\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ralecon.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/Core-Principles_-Understanding-the-Engine-2.png\" alt=\"\" width=\"750\" height=\"450\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.ralecon.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/Core-Principles_-Understanding-the-Engine-2.png 750w, https:\/\/www.ralecon.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/Core-Principles_-Understanding-the-Engine-2-300x180.png 300w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 750px) 100vw, 750px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li aria-level=\"1\">\n<h3><b>Traditional SEO: The Foundation of Discoverability<\/b><\/h3>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Traditional SEO focuses on optimizing your website for search engine indexing and ranking algorithms. The goal is simple. Help your pages appear prominently in search results for relevant queries.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This includes keyword research (finding popular search terms), backlink building (getting links from other websites), technical site health (fixing website performance and errors), optimized meta tags (improving page titles and descriptions), internal linking (connecting pages within the site), and structuring content to be easy to navigate. With Google handling over <\/span><strong><a href=\"https:\/\/seo.ai\/blog\/how-many-people-use-google#:~:text=How%20Many%20People%20Use%20Google%20a%20Day?,%E2%80%8D\">8.5 billion searches daily<\/a><\/strong><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, SEO remains crucial for businesses seeking steady inbound visibility.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Strong SEO ensures your content is discoverable, crawlable, and competitive. Without it, even the best content struggles to surface.<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li aria-level=\"1\">\n<h3><b>AISO: Optimizing for Understanding and Dialogue<\/b><\/h3>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">AISO, or Artificial Intelligence Search Optimization, centers on how AI assistants understand, interpret, and present information. Semantic search means finding results based on meaning and context, not just words. Topical authority refers to expertise in a subject, while trust signals are cues that suggest a source is reliable. These systems depend on these factors more than on keyword density alone.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">AISO prioritizes clear explanations, natural language formatting (writing that reads as people speak), structured Q&amp;A sections (organized question-and-answer formats), and strong E-E-A-T signals (showing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ness). The goal is to become the source an AI assistant selects when generating a direct answer, summary, or recommendation.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Recent studies indicate that over <\/span><strong><a href=\"https:\/\/www.linkedin.com\/pulse\/did-you-know-nearly-60-consumers-now-say-trust-ai-generated-gunoe\">60 percent of users trust AI-generated answers<\/a><\/strong><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> for informational queries. Fast load times, mobile optimization, clean architecture, and structured data affect whether AI trusts and recommends your source.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>How to Optimize for Both SEO and AISO?<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">To stay competitive in 2026, businesses must align content for both search engines and AI systems. This means combining technical strength with conversational clarity. Start by building topic clusters that cover a subject in depth while targeting primary and related keywords. Structure your content with clear headings, concise answers, and FAQ sections that AI tools can easily extract.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Focus on credibility by adding real insights, case studies, and expert perspectives. At the same time, ensure your website performs well with fast loading speeds, mobile responsiveness, and structured data. When your content is both discoverable and understandable, it increases the chances of ranking on search engines and being cited by AI assistants.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>Conclusion<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The real decision is not SEO or AISO. Is SEO dead in 2026?<\/strong><\/h4>\n<div>Not at all. SEO continues to be the backbone of digital visibility. What has changed is how users interact with search. With AI-powered platforms delivering direct answers, businesses need to go beyond rankings and focus on being selected as a trusted source. SEO still drives discoverability, while AISO ensures relevance in AI-driven experiences.<\/div>\n<div><\/div>\n<h4><strong>2. What is AISO (Artificial Intelligence Search Optimization)?<\/strong><\/h4>\n<div>AISO is about making your content easy for AI systems to understand, trust, and present as answers. It focuses on clarity, context, and authority rather than just keywords. When done right, it helps your brand become the source AI assistants rely on for accurate and meaningful responses.<\/div>\n<div><\/div>\n<h4><strong>3. How is AISO different from traditional SEO?<\/strong><\/h4>\n<div>The difference lies in intent and outcome. SEO is designed to improve visibility in search engine rankings, while AISO is focused on being chosen within AI-generated responses. SEO relies more on technical signals and keywords, whereas AISO prioritises meaning, structure, and credibility.<\/div>\n<div><\/div>\n<h4><strong>4. Can small businesses benefit from AISO?<\/strong><\/h4>\n<div>Absolutely. AISO creates a level playing field where clarity and expertise matter more than brand size. Small businesses that produce focused, high-quality content with real insights can compete effectively and even outperform larger brands in AI-driven search results.<\/div>\n<div><\/div>\n<h4><strong>5. How can businesses prepare for AI-driven search in 2026?<\/strong><\/h4>\n<div>Preparation starts with integration. Strengthen your technical SEO, build content around clear topics, and structure it in a way that answers real user questions. Add trust signals such as expertise and real-world experience. The goal is simple: make your content easy to find, easy to understand, and easy to trust across both search engines and AI platforms.<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<!-- AddThis Advanced Settings generic via filter on the_content --><!-- AddThis Share Buttons generic via filter on the_content -->","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Search is no longer limited to ten blue links.
